1 What Makes IQ Important?

Intelligence Quotient (IQ) represents one of the most reliable and valid psychological constructs ever discovered. Unlike many psychological measures, IQ scores demonstrate remarkable stability over time—test-retest correlations often exceed .90 across decades—and predict a wide range of real-world outcomes with considerable accuracy.

The importance of IQ extends far beyond academic settings. Research spanning over a century has consistently shown that cognitive ability serves as a foundational trait influencing success across virtually every domain of human endeavor. This doesn't mean IQ is destiny—environmental factors, motivation, personality, and opportunity all play crucial roles—but it does mean understanding your cognitive profile provides valuable insights for personal development and life planning.

Renowned psychologist Linda Gottfredson has described g (general intelligence) as "a highly general capability for processing complex information of any type." This capacity influences how quickly we learn, how effectively we solve problems, and how well we adapt to new situations—skills relevant to nearly every aspect of modern life.

2 Academic and Educational Outcomes

IQ is the single strongest predictor of academic achievement, surpassing factors like socioeconomic status, parental education, and school quality. Studies consistently find correlations of .50 to .70 between IQ and grades, indicating that roughly 25-50% of the variance in academic performance can be attributed to cognitive ability. Research by Deary et al. (2007) in the journal Intelligence provides comprehensive evidence for this relationship.

  • Educational Attainment: Each standard deviation increase in IQ (15 points) is associated with approximately 2.5 additional years of education. Higher IQ individuals are more likely to pursue and complete advanced degrees.
  • Learning Efficiency: Individuals with higher cognitive ability typically acquire new knowledge and skills more rapidly. They require fewer repetitions to master material and can handle greater informational complexity.
  • Complex Problem Solving: Higher IQ enables better handling of abstract, multi-step academic problems across disciplines from mathematics to literary analysis.
  • Standardized Testing: IQ correlates strongly (.70-.85) with performance on standardized tests like the SAT, ACT, GRE, LSAT, and MCAT.
  • Academic Honors: Students with higher IQs are significantly more likely to graduate with honors, win academic awards, and gain admission to selective institutions.

3 Career and Occupational Success

IQ is a powerful predictor of job performance across virtually all occupations. The landmark meta-analyses by Hunter and Schmidt (1998) and subsequent researchers have established that general cognitive ability predicts job success with correlations of .50 to .60 for complex jobs and .20 to .30 for simpler roles.

The relationship between IQ and occupational success is particularly strong for jobs requiring learning, problem-solving, and adaptation to new situations. In knowledge-economy careers, cognitive ability becomes even more predictive as the complexity of work increases.

  • Job Performance: IQ predicts performance ratings, productivity measures, objective work samples, and supervisor evaluations. It is the single best predictor of job performance across all occupations studied.
  • Income: Research suggests each additional IQ point above the mean is associated with approximately 1-2% higher lifetime earnings. The top 1% of IQ (135+) earn on average 3-4 times the median income.
  • Occupational Prestige: Higher cognitive ability is strongly associated with entry into professional and managerial positions. The average IQ of physicians, engineers, and professors exceeds 125.
  • Training Success: IQ predicts how quickly and effectively employees can be trained for new roles, master new software systems, and adapt to organizational changes.
  • Leadership: Studies find moderate positive correlations between IQ and leadership emergence, particularly in complex organizational environments.
  • Entrepreneurship: While personality factors also matter greatly, higher IQ is associated with successful business formation and survival.

4 Health and Longevity

Perhaps surprisingly, IQ measured in childhood predicts longevity and health outcomes decades later. The "cognitive epidemiology" literature has documented robust associations between intelligence and mortality, with each 15-point increase in IQ associated with approximately 20% lower mortality risk.

The Scottish Mental Surveys of 1932 and 1947 tested nearly every 11-year-old in Scotland and have enabled researchers to track health outcomes over 70+ years. These studies consistently show that childhood IQ predicts adult health independent of socioeconomic factors. See Deary (2004) for an overview of cognitive epidemiology.

  • Health Behaviors: Higher IQ is associated with better health decisions, including lower rates of smoking (correlation -.25), reduced substance abuse, better diet choices, and more regular exercise.
  • Medical Adherence: Individuals with higher cognitive ability better understand complex medical regimens, remember to take medications, and follow preventive care recommendations.
  • Accident Prevention: Higher IQ is associated with lower rates of accidental injury and death, likely reflecting better judgment in risky situations.
  • Cardiovascular Health: Research shows ~24% lower coronary heart disease risk per standard deviation increase in IQ.
  • Mental Health: While the relationship is complex, higher IQ generally provides protective effects against some mental disorders, though it may increase risk for certain conditions like anxiety.
  • Dementia: Higher childhood IQ is associated with reduced risk of late-life dementia, possibly through greater "cognitive reserve."

5 Social and Life Outcomes

IQ influences numerous aspects of daily life and social functioning. Research shows associations with relationship quality, civic participation, financial decisions, and overall life satisfaction.

  • Financial Literacy: Higher IQ is associated with better understanding of financial concepts like compound interest, risk diversification, and long-term planning, leading to greater wealth accumulation independent of income.
  • Decision Making: Cognitive ability predicts quality of decisions across domains from health to finance to personal relationships. Higher IQ individuals show less susceptibility to cognitive biases and better calibration of confidence.
  • Law-Abiding Behavior: Higher IQ is associated with lower rates of criminal behavior and incarceration. The correlation between IQ and criminality is approximately -.20 even after controlling for socioeconomic status.
  • Civic Engagement: More cognitively able individuals tend to participate more actively in democratic processes, including voting, following current events, and engaging in community organizations.
  • Relationship Stability: Some research suggests higher IQ is associated with lower divorce rates, possibly reflecting better conflict resolution and long-term planning.
  • Parenting: Higher IQ parents tend to create more cognitively stimulating home environments and invest more in their children's education.

6 The Limits of IQ

While IQ is an important predictor of many life outcomes, it's crucial to understand its limitations:

  • It's Not Everything: Personality traits (especially conscientiousness), motivation, social skills, creativity, and emotional intelligence all contribute to success independently of IQ.
  • Environment Matters: Opportunity, education quality, family support, and socioeconomic factors significantly influence outcomes regardless of cognitive ability.
  • Diminishing Returns: Beyond a certain threshold (often cited as ~120), additional IQ points contribute less to real-world success as other factors become more important.
  • Domain Specificity: High IQ doesn't guarantee success in every area—people can be cognitively gifted but struggle with specific skills or domains.
  • Malleability: IQ is not completely fixed. Early interventions, education, and challenging cognitive activities can influence cognitive development, particularly in childhood.

7 The Value of Understanding Your IQ

Knowing your cognitive profile offers several practical benefits for personal development and life planning:

  • Self-Understanding: IQ testing provides objective insights into your cognitive strengths and areas where you might need to compensate with extra effort or different strategies.
  • Career Planning: Understanding your cognitive profile can help guide educational and career decisions toward fields that match your abilities.
  • Learning Strategies: Identifying specific cognitive strengths and weaknesses enables tailored learning approaches. Someone strong in verbal but weaker in visual-spatial abilities might prefer reading to diagrams.
  • Realistic Expectations: A clear understanding of abilities helps set achievable goals and appropriate challenges—neither too easy nor impossibly difficult.
  • Identifying Potential Issues: Large discrepancies between cognitive domains can sometimes indicate learning disabilities or processing differences that benefit from early intervention.
  • Appreciation of Diversity: Understanding cognitive variation promotes appreciation for different types of intelligence and the various ways people can contribute to society.
